thought leaders. Data lineage (DL) Data lineage is a metadata construct. Lineage is also used for data quality analysis, compliance and what if scenarios often referred to as impact analysis. The best data lineage definition is that it includes every aspect of the lifecycle of the data itself including where/how it originates, what changes it undergoes, and where it moves over time. In the Google Cloud console, open the Instances page. But sometimes, there is no direct way to extract data lineage. Alation; data catalog; data lineage; enterprise data catalog; Table of Contents. Blog: 7 Ways Good Data Security Practices Drive Data Governance. Software benefits include: One central metadata repository After the migration, the destination is the new source of migrated data, and the original source is retired. Like data migration, data maps for integrations match source fields with destination fields. . Process design data lineage vs value data lineage. Definition and Examples, Talend Job Design Patterns and Best Practices: Part 4, Talend Job Design Patterns and Best Practices: Part 3, data standards, reporting requirements, and systems, Talend Data Fabric is a unified suite of apps, Understanding Data Migration: Strategy and Best Practices, Talend Job Design Patterns and Best Practices: Part 2, Talend Job Design Patterns and Best Practices: Part 1, Experience the magic of shuffling columns in Talend Dynamic Schema, Day-in-the-Life of a Data Integration Developer: How to Build Your First Talend Job, Overcoming Healthcares Data Integration Challenges, An Informatica PowerCenter Developers Guide to Talend: Part 3, An Informatica PowerCenter Developers Guide to Talend: Part 2, 5 Data Integration Methods and Strategies, An Informatica PowerCenter Developers' Guide to Talend: Part 1, Best Practices for Using Context Variables with Talend: Part 2, Best Practices for Using Context Variables with Talend: Part 3, Best Practices for Using Context Variables with Talend: Part 4, Best Practices for Using Context Variables with Talend: Part 1. Is lineage a map of your data and analytics, a graph of nodes and edges that describes and sometimes visually shows the journey your data takes, from start to finish, from raw source data, to transformed data, to compute metrics and everything in between? Get better returns on your data investments by allowing teams to profit from Here is how lineage is performed across different stages of the data pipeline: Imperva provides data discovery and classification, revealing the location, volume, and context of data on-premises and in the cloud. self-service Data maps are not a one-and-done deal. Hence, its usage is to understand, find, govern, and regulate data. This technique performs lineage without dealing with the code used to generate or transform the data. It is often the first step in the process of executing end-to-end data integration. If not properly mapped, data may become corrupted as it moves to its destination. Different groups of stakeholders have different requirements for data lineage. This can include cleansing data by changing data types, deleting nulls or duplicates, aggregating data, enriching the data, or other transformations. Where the true power of traceability (and, Enabling customizable traceability, or business lineage views that combine both business and technical information, is critical to understanding data and using it effectively and the next step into establishing. Impact analysis reports show the dependencies between assets. A data mapping solution establishes a relationship between a data source and the target schema. Before data can be analyzed for business insights, it must be homogenized in a way that makes it accessible to decision makers. Data-lineage documents help organizations map data flow pathways with Personally Identifiable Information to store and transmit it according to applicable regulations. Knowing who made the change, how it was updated, and the process used, improves data quality. Whereas data lineage tracks data throughout the complete lifecycle, data provenance zooms in on the data origin. Very often data lineage initiatives look to surface details on the exact nature and even the transform code embedded in each of the transformations. In this way, impacted parties can navigate to the area or elements of the data lineage that they need to manage or use to obtain clarity and a precise understanding. Additionally, data mapping helps organizations comply with regulations like GDPR by ensuring they know exactly where and how their . Maximize your data lake investment with the ability to discover, This method is only effective if you have a consistent transformation tool that controls all data movement, and you are aware of the tagging structure used by the tool. Hear from the many customers across the world that partner with Collibra on their data intelligence journey. Tracking data generated, uploaded and altered by business users and applications. Predict outcomes faster using a platform built with data fabric architecture. AI-Powered Data Lineage: The New Business Imperative. There is definitely a lot of confusion on this point, and the distinctions made between what is data lineage and data provenance are subtle since they both cover the data from source to use. It provides a solid foundation for data security strategies by helping understand where sensitive and regulated data is stored, both locally and in the cloud. Enabling customizable traceability, or business lineage views that combine both business and technical information, is critical to understanding data and using it effectively and the next step into establishing data as a trusted asset in the organization. The following section covers the details about the granularity of which the lineage information is gathered by Microsoft Purview. ETL software, BI tools, relational database management systems, modeling tools, enterprise applications and custom applications all create their own data about your data. To round out automation capabilities, look for a tool that can create a complete mapping workflow with the ability to schedule mapping jobs triggered by the calendar or an event. The information is combined to represent a generic, scenario-specific lineage experience in the Catalog. This includes the availability, ownership, sensitivity and quality of data. Centralize, govern and certify key BI reports and metrics to make Data lineage is the process of tracking the flow of data over time, providing a clear understanding of where the data originated, how it has changed, and its ultimate destination within the data pipeline. It should trace everything from source to target, and be flexible enough to encompass . This article set out to explain what it is, its importance today, and the basics of how it works, as well as to open the question of why graph databases are uniquely suited as the data store for data lineage, data provenance and related analytics projects. Is the FSI innovation rush leaving your data and application security controls behind? How is it Different from Data Lineage? Get the latest data cataloging news and trends in your inbox. deliver trusted data. Data mapping bridges the differences between two systems, or data models, so that when data is moved from a source, it is accurate and usable at the destination. In some cases, it can miss connections between datasets, especially if the data processing logic is hidden in the programming code and is not apparent in human-readable metadata. Mapping by hand also means coding transformations by hand, which is time consuming and fraught with error. Click to reveal Data lineage clarifies how data flows across the organization. In addition, data classification can improve user productivity and decision making, remove unnecessary data, and reduce storage and maintenance costs. Just knowing the source of a particular data set is not always enough to understand its importance, perform error resolution, understand process changes, and perform system migrations and updates. It also provides security and IT teams with full visibility into how the data is being accessed, used, and moved around the organization. The major advantage of pattern-based lineage is that it only monitors data, not data processing algorithms, and so it is technology agnostic. Data lineage is declined in several approaches. improve data transparency Since data qualityis important, data analysts and architects need a precise, real time view of the data at its source and destination. This granularity can vary based on the data systems supported in Microsoft Purview. It helps data scientists gain granular visibility of data dynamics and enables them to trace errors back to the root cause. And different systems store similar data in different ways. Compliance: Data lineage provides a compliance mechanism for auditing, improving risk management, and ensuring data is stored and processed in line with data governance policies and regulations. 192.53.166.92 Adobe, Honeywell, T-Mobile, and SouthWest are some renowned companies that use Collibra. That being said, data provenance tends to be more high-level, documenting at the system level, often for business users so they can understand roughly where the data comes from, while data lineage is concerned with all the details of data preparation, cleansing, transformation- even down to the data element level in many cases. You can select the subject area for each of the Fusion Analytics Warehouse products and review the data lineage details. It provides insight into where data comes from and how it gets created by looking at important details like inputs, entities, systems, and processes for the data. Proactively improve and maintain the quality of your business-critical All rights reserved, Learn how automated threats and API attacks on retailers are increasing, No tuning, highly-accurate out-of-the-box, Effective against OWASP top 10 vulnerabilities. Microsoft Purview Data Catalog will connect with other data processing, storage, and analytics systems to extract lineage information. The implementation of data lineage requires various . Communicate with the owners of the tools and applications that create metadata about your data. This requirement has nothing to do with replacing the monitoring capabilities of other data processing systems, neither the goal is to replace them. Data lineage gives visibility into changes that may occur as a result of data migrations, system updates, errors and more, ensuring data integrity throughout its lifecycle. This is because these diagrams show as built transformations, staging tables, look ups, etc. Those two columns are then linked together in a data lineage chart. compliantly access For example, deleting a column that is used in a join can impact a report that depends on that join. This can help you identify critical datasets to perform detailed data lineage analysis. Some of the ways that teams can leverage end-to-end data lineage tools to improve workflows include: Data modeling: To create visual representations of the different data elements and their corresponding linkages within an enterprise, companies must define the underlying data structures that support them. Further processing of data into analytical models for optimal query performance and aggregation. The transform instruction (T) records the processing steps that were used to manipulate the data source. Learn more about MANTA packages designed for each solution and the extra features available. With so much data streaming from diverse sources, data compatibility becomes a potential problem. Data Lineage Demystified. Data Lineage vs. Data Provenance. Take back control of your data landscape to increase trust in data and Power BI's data lineage view helps you answer these questions. Start by validating high-level connections between systems. With Data Lineage, you can access a clear and precise visual output of all your data. For data teams, the three main advantages of data lineage include reducing root-cause analysis headaches, minimizing unexpected downstream headaches when making upstream changes, and empowering business users. If the goal is to pool data into one source for analysis or other tasks, it is generally pooled in a data warehouse. In most cases, it is done to ensure that multiple systems have a copy of the same data. Data lineage and impact analysis reports show the movement of data within a job or through multiple jobs. (Metadata is defined as "data describing other sets of data".)